LDS-1650-DFB-1.25G-10/20
OVERVIEW
LDS-1650-DFB-1.25G-10/20 is a laser diode coupled to an optical fiber
The special feature of the LDS technology is the increased thermal stability of optical power
MAIN FEATURES
• Wavelength: 1650 nm
• Cavity type: DFB
• Linewidth < 500 kHz
• Data rate up to 1.25 Gbps
• Optical power: up to 10 mW in CW mode and up to 20 mW in pulse mode
• Typical thermal stability of optical power (tracking error) 0.15 dB
• Package types: coaxial
• Built-in monitor photodiode
APPLICATIONS
• Optical fiber systems
• Laser systems
